    <title>Transfer of equity Instruments of an Indian Company by FPI</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/acts?id=37909</link>
    <description>Rule 11 permits a Foreign Portfolio Investor to transfer equity instruments of an Indian company or units held in accordance with the applicable rules, subject to conditions in the annexed Schedules, specified terms, and securities-regulatory requirements. Prior Government approval is required where the investee company operates in a sector requiring approval. If an acquisition under Schedule II breaches aggregate FPI or sectoral limits, the corrective mechanism under Schedule II applies.</description>
